Transaction 91a89a452418c29ff5430dfd07c0365f443ba636753883148c398a927c15cbff
1 Input
1 Outputs
- 91a89a452418c29ff5430dfd07c0365f443ba636753883148c398a927c15cbff:0
value 27851
address 2MteRAVyx4nN5eoUrELNBQNMDWZzAGFx3Wr